d. Placards for vehicles carrying
explosive or other dangerous
articles
(1) Over public highways
Placards will be used in
accordance with applicable DOT
regulations and AR 55-355.
(2) In training areas
Placards will be used in
accordance with applicable DOT
regulations and AR 385-63.

f. Flags (all vehicles not painted
in accordance with items 2 and 9
of this table and e above).
Vehicles will bear a distinctive flag
whenever operating on landing
areas, runways, taxiways, or
peripheral roads at airfields. The
flag will be square, at least 3 feet
on each side, and will be divided
into 9 equal size squares forming
a checkerboard pattern with the
center and the corner squares in
international orange and the
remaining 4 squares in white.
A red flag will be mounted on
vehicles to indicate danger when
considered necessary to caution
personnel of a hazardous
condition in the area.
